November Weather in Salmon

Last updated: March 2, 2024

The weather in Salmon, United States, during November is characterized by an average temperature of -3°C (27°F). Highs can soar to 10°C (51°F), while lows may dip to -21°C (-6°F). Typically, the humidity level in Salmon throughout November hovers around 91%.

Precipitation and Sunshine hours

In November, Salmon averages 54 mm (2.1 inches) of rainfall, typically over the course of 13 rainy days. The month enjoys an average of 9 hours 30 minutes of daylight, with the sun shining for approximately 6 hours 17 minutes each day. Additionally, there is a 32% probability of sunny days during this period.

UV Index

In November, the UV Index in Salmon reaches a maximum of 4, indicating a level of Moderate exposure. The most intense UV radiation typically occurs between 13:00 and 15:00, during which unprotected skin may burn in as little as 30 minutes.
